Transaction e08d69c33e743fc58766b39ae72323b5dddbf968fd69f49a47f2a6cf7bc52471
1 Input
1 Output
-
e08d69c33e743fc58766b39ae72323b5dddbf968fd69f49a47f2a6cf7bc52471:0
- value
- 297793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 219abba94208355c2d2ae9ad836ee899036716aa OP_EQUAL
- address
- 34khav2UfGUymS3iJG7TZmdr5CuKmwfxEc